Ember快速入门指南:构建并开发首个Ember.js应用程序

需积分: 5 0 下载量 37 浏览量 更新于2024-12-25 收藏 185KB ZIP 举报
资源摘要信息:"Ember.js是一种开源的JavaScript框架,用于开发Web应用。它提供了一套完整的工具和约定,帮助开发人员高效地构建前端应用。Ember.js采用MVC(模型-视图-控制器)架构,以及一套数据绑定、路由管理以及模板渲染的机制,使得开发复杂单页面应用变得简单。Ember-quickstart则是一个针对初学者的入门项目,它基于官方Ember.js指南,旨在帮助新手快速上手并理解Ember.js的基本用法。" 在本快速入门应用程序中,我们首先需要安装一些先决条件,以便在计算机上运行Ember.js应用程序。根据文件描述,我们需要安装git和npm,它们是开发者日常工作中不可或缺的版本控制工具和JavaScript包管理器。通过使用npm,我们可以非常方便地管理项目依赖,以及运行项目所需的脚本。 1. 安装步骤: - 使用git克隆仓库到本地计算机:`git clone <repository>`。 - 进入项目目录:`cd ember-quickstart`。 - 安装项目依赖:`npm install`。 2. 运行与开发: - 启动开发服务器:`ember serve`。启动后,我们可以通过默认的URL(如http://localhost:4200)访问我们的应用程序。这允许我们在浏览器中实时查看代码更改效果。 - 访问应用程序:开发服务器启动后,我们可以在浏览器中输入地址访问应用。 - 访问测试:Ember.js项目提供了一套强大的测试框架,通过运行`ember test`或`ember test --server`,我们可以进行单元测试和集成测试,前者为单次执行测试,后者则会持续运行并监控文件变动,以便重新执行测试。 3. 代码生成器: - Ember.js通过其命令行界面(CLI)提供了一整套代码生成器,可以快速生成各种文件,比如组件、模型、路由、视图等。使用`ember help generate`可以获得更详细的帮助信息和可用的生成器列表。 4. 运行测试: - Ember.js强调测试驱动开发,因此提供了命令来运行测试,包括`ember test`和`ember test --server`。 5. 代码风格检查: - 为了维护代码的一致性和可读性,Ember.js推荐使用ESLint来检查JavaScript代码风格,并使用`ember-template-lint`来检查Handlebars模板。命令`npm run lint:hbs`和`npm run lint:js`可执行相应的检查,`npm run lint:js -- --fix`还会自动修复可修复的问题。 6. 构建: - 当需要构建应用以便部署到生产环境时,可以使用`ember build`命令。该命令会创建生产环境的文件,通常存放在项目的`dist/`目录下。构建过程中可以指定环境,例如`ember build --environment production`,以确保应用在生产环境中的性能和优化。 以上步骤和命令是Ember.js开发者在日常工作中频繁使用的,它们是开发Ember.js应用的基础。掌握了这些基础命令和工作流后,开发者可以更深入地学习Ember.js的高级特性和模式,构建出更加复杂和功能丰富的Web应用。